تبلیغات
دانلود نرم افزار وبازی بالینک مستقیم +مطالب کمیاب - کد محاسبه دترمینان ماتریس n در n
 
دانلود نرم افزار وبازی بالینک مستقیم +مطالب کمیاب
در این وبسایت از لینک های مستقیم استفاده شده برای راحتی شما هم موبایل و هم کامپیوتر
صفحه نخست            تماس با مدیر            پست الکترونیک           RSS            ATOM
درباره وبلاگ


پنجره ها کلافه اند از سنگینی نگاه منتظرم اگر نمی ایی اینقدر پنجره ها را زجر ندهم چشمهایم به جهنم


مدیر وبلاگ : saman ....
مطالب اخیر
نویسندگان
نظرسنجی
نظرتون درمورد سایت من چیه؟













#include<iostream>
#include<conio.h>
#include<math.h>
#include<process.h>
using namespace std;
int main()
{
 int determinant(int[5][5],int);// FUNCTIONS
 void read(int[5][5],int);
 void print(int[5][5],int);     //           PROTOYPES
 int a[5][5],l,n;
 int result;
 cout<<"chand dar chand???";



    
 cin>>l>>n;
 if(l!=n)
  {                                               //TESTING CONDITION
    cout<<"SORRY!!!!!\n                ONLY SQUARE MATRIX";
    //goto l1;
  }
 read(a,n);
 result = determinant(a,n);
 print(a,n);
 cout<<endl<<"theterminan:"<<result;
 getch();
}


void read(int b[5][5],int m)     //FUNCTION FOR READING MATRIX
{
 cout<<"ENTER "<<m*m<<" ELEMENTS OF MATRIX(ROW-WISE):";
 for(int i=0;i<m;i++)
  for(int j=0;j<m;j++)
    cin>>b[i][j];
}


void print(int b[5][5],int m)
{
 cout<<"MATRIX IS :-";
 for(int i=0;i<m;i++)
 {
  cout<<"\n";
  for(int j=0;j<m;j++)
    cout<<"    "<<b[i][j];
 }
}

int determinant(int b[5][5],int m)   //FUNCTION TO CALCULATE 
{
 int i,j,sum = 0,c[5][5];
 if(m==2)
  {                                        //BASE CONDITION
    sum = b[0][0]*b[1][1] - b[0][1]*b[1][0];
    return sum;
  }
 for(int p=0;p<m;p++)
 {
  int h = 0,k = 0;
  for(i=1;i<m;i++)
  {
    for( j=0;j<m;j++)
    {
     if(j==p)
      continue;
     c[h][k] = b[i][j];
     k++;
     if(k == m-1)
      {
         h++;
         k = 0;
      }

    }
  }

  sum = sum + b[0][p]*pow(-1,p)*determinant(c,m-1);
 }
 return sum;
}



//Author :saman amirshojaey
//EmaiL : saman_amirshojaey@Yahoo.Com
//Site : www.hakerpc.mihanblog.com







نوع مطلب : درسی اموزشی، 
برچسب ها : کد، محاسبه، دترمینان، ماتریس، C++، ++C، برنامه نویسی،
لینک های مرتبط :

یکشنبه 12 مرداد 1393
سه شنبه 2 خرداد 1396 04:07 ق.ظ
certainly like your web-site but you need to check the spelling on quite a
few of your posts. A number of them are rife with spelling problems and I to find it very bothersome to tell the truth nevertheless I'll definitely come back again.
 
لبخندناراحتچشمک
نیشخندبغلسوال
قلبخجالتزبان
ماچتعجبعصبانی
عینکشیطانگریه
خندهقهقههخداحافظ
سبزقهرهورا
دستگلتفکر


موضوعات
آمار وبلاگ
  • کل بازدید :
  • بازدید امروز :
  • بازدید دیروز :
  • بازدید این ماه :
  • بازدید ماه قبل :
  • تعداد نویسندگان :
  • تعداد کل پست ها :
  • آخرین بازدید :
  • آخرین بروز رسانی :
کسب درآمد